Carbonate hardness (KH) is a temporarily hardness and is used within the aquarium system to stabilize pH, Large Predator KH plus has been formulated to set the pH at 7.50.

Biotope Large Predator KH plus is a phosphate free product.

Biotope Large Predator KH plus is based on the carbon cycle and not on using phosphates.

In the aquarium hobby the carbon cycle is not talked about very often, most hobbyist know about the nitrogen cycle, and the dangers of ammonia, nitrite and nitrate, but know little about the carbon cycle.

In very basic terms the carbon cycle is based around carbon dioxide, carbonates, bicarbonates and pH.

Carbon dioxide in water is an acid, carbonates and bicarbonate are on the neutral to alkaline side of the pH scale.

Carbon dioxide gas is continuously being produced in the aquarium by the fish, plants and the filtration system, while carbonates and bicarbonates are not produced within the system, it is this in balance that causes the pH to crash.

Biotope Large Predator KH plus is a blend of carbonates and bicarbonates, when added to the aquarium they will react with carbon dioxide, this reaction will convert the free carbon dioxide gas into the chemical compound carbonic acid and stabilize the pH at 7.50.

Biotope Large Predator KH plus will increase the KH level of the water, it is this level that will determine the pH.

We recommend a KH of 8 degrees for the average Large Predator aquarium, this level will set the pH at 7.50, however pH can also be influenced by other factors, the number of fish, water changes, aquatic plants.

Most Large Predator aquariums with a KH of 8 degrees will have pH 7.50.

If the pH at 8 degrees KH is higher or lower than 7.50 the KH level can be increased or decreased to suit the water chemistry of the aquarium.

pH stability is the most important factor when keeping fish, if the pH is slightly higher than 7.50 and stable at that level that will be fine, leaving the KH at 8degrees (the recommended dose rate) will keep the aquarium in great condition.

Dosage

With each water change add

5g (1 teaspoon) to 5 litres of newly added water to increase the KH by 8 degrees.
